Subject: Wiki RBAC cut-over done

Plugin authors — the Mirelight wiki now enforces role-based access on all plugin endpoints. Legacy token checks were removed last night. Plugins must declare required roles in their manifest; undeclared calls get a 403. Update and republish before the grace window closes. The enforcement settings now active are listed below.

service settings:
PRAIX_LOG_LEVEL=error
PRAIX_METRICS_HOST=metrics.praix.qorvelcorp.corp
PRAIX_POOL_SIZE=16

## Runbook: Publishing Tilekit Components

Tilekit follows strict semver: breaking prop changes bump major, new components bump minor. On-call publishes only from the release branch after the version-diff check passes. If consumers report mismatched versions, verify the lockfile before rolling back. Every published package must be signed or downstream installs will fail verification. Use the publishing key below.

deploy key for kajof-fajop: bky6_gDHw9Q

# Proselint-D Environments

Proselint-D lints our docs repos. Two environments: staging (runs on draft branches, non-blocking) and prod (gates merges to main). Rule sets differ: staging enables experimental checks; prod runs the stable set only. Reviewers: a passing staging run does not imply prod will pass. Exemptions live in the repo manifest, not the linter. Prod currently runs with the following configuration values.

config for kafof-bawef:
holath:
  log_level: debug
  metrics_host: metrics.holath.qorvelsys.internal
  pin: 2191
  pool_size: 32